Pennington Presbyterian to offer discussion on COVID and the local schools

by Community Contributor

“The Pandemic and Hopewell Valley Schools: Challenge, Response, Lessons Learned.” Dr. Thomas A. Smith, Superintendent of the Hopewell Valley Regional School District, will speak and answer questions about this interesting and important topic, via Zoom, on Friday, February 19.

The program is offered by the Older Adult Ministry Committee of the Pennington Presbyterian Church, as part of its well-established Brown Bag Lunch Program series. The program is designed to inform those who do not have connections with the school system about the ways in which the schools grappled with the pandemic over the past year to maximize both learning and safety.
